Former Mombasa Governor Hassan Joho was among Kenyan fans who thronged the Uhuru Gardens Saturday, June 10 for the most anticipated Stanbic Yetu Festival.

US band Boyz II Men were the main acts while Sauti Sol curtain raised for them. Joho was spotted walking through the crowd and female fans screamed in excitement at seeing him in person.

 

He smiled brightly and gave hi-fives to fans in attendance beaming as guards protected him.

Joho in an interview with Mpasho's Dennis Milimo told that he had a blast when the musicians took to the stage.

"It was amazing it was good, and I like the fact that it ended at ten o'clock so we can go home, eat, and sleep"

 

Boyz II Men lit up the stage when they began at 9 pm to an excited crowd.

The Us group performed their chart-topping hits and for Joho, all songs are great, but End of the Road is his absolute favorite

"It was amazing, but End of the Road is quite something, we belong together" he disclosed.

Joho gushed over Saut Sol as well for their epic performance

"Oh great, Sauti Sol we love them"

A slew of A-listers came out to watch the show documenting how they had the time of their lives at the festival including Mama Nyaguthii, Isabella Kituri, Jacky Vike, Ben Soul, Amira, and Nyashinski among others.
